Hey - I've left some high level feedback:

  • Instead of shelling out to gh workflow run with actions: write permissions, consider converting publish-docker.yml and publish-pypi.yml to workflow_call-triggered workflows and calling them via uses: so dependencies are explicit and you avoid the extra CLI dependency and token scope.
  • With the new type=semver,pattern={{major}} tag added, double-check whether the type=ref,event=branch tag is still needed; if you no longer want branch-based tags, removing that entry will prevent unexpected extra image tags being published.

65-73: Version parsing assumes no 'v' prefix.

The script splits inputs.version directly on ., which works for 1.2.3 but would break if the caller passes v1.2.3. While the release workflow correctly passes only the numeric version (needs.bump.outputs.new_version), consider adding a strip for robustness:

 run: |
   set -euo pipefail
+  VERSION="${{ inputs.version }}"
+  VERSION="${VERSION#v}"
-  IFS='.' read -r MA MI PA <<< "${{ inputs.version }}"
+  IFS='.' read -r MA MI PA <<< "$VERSION"
   echo "major=$MA" >> "$GITHUB_OUTPUT"
   echo "minor=$MI" >> "$GITHUB_OUTPUT"

Short summary of recent breaking changes and pinning recommendations for astral-sh/setup-uv

Breaking changes to be aware of

  • setup-uv v7: switched runtime from Node 20 → Node 24 and removed the deprecated server-url input (breaking for out-of-date self-hosted runners or workflows relying on server-url). [1]
  • uv 0.9.x (upstream) made Python 3.14 the default stable Python and noted potential breaking behavior if you do not pin Python versions. (This is an upstream uv release note you should consider when installing uv in CI.) [2]

Recommended version-pinning and workflow practices

  1. Pin the action major tag (and optionally patch) — e.g. uses: astral-sh/setup-uv@v7 — to avoid unexpected breaking changes from new major releases. [1]
  2. Pin the uv binary version explicitly in the action inputs: with: version: "0.9.18" (or whatever exact uv release you need). This prevents automatic upgrades when the action installs the “latest”. [3][1]
  3. Pin the Python version you want uv to use:
    • Either set with: python-version: "3.13" (or desired) in setup-uv, or
    • Use actions/setup-python before setup-uv and set python-version-file / python-version explicitly. This avoids surprising default upgrades (e.g., to Python 3.14). [1][2]
  4. Use a version-file (uv.toml or pyproject.toml) or the action input version-file to centralize the pinned uv version; set resolution-strategy if using ranges. [1]
  5. If you rely on caching or self-hosted runners, ensure runners/tools meet v7’s Node 24 requirement; update self-hosted runners if necessary. [1][3]
  6. For safety in CI: use the action output uv-version to assert the expected installed version in later steps, and enable checksum/manifest options if you download from custom sources. [1][3]

Pin uv to a specific version (e.g., 0.9.21) instead of "latest" for reproducibility.

Using version: "latest" can lead to unexpected build failures when uv releases introduce breaking changes. Recent versions have introduced breaking behavior (e.g., uv 0.9.x changed the default Python version to 3.14). Pin to an exact version like version: "0.9.21" to ensure consistent and predictable builds, aligning with your stability requirements.
